A flock of wild turkeys estimated to number around 100 birds has become a major nuisance in one Staten Island, NY neighborhood, tying up traffic, covering yards with feces, and even trapping a woman in her car. "They come in droves by the hundreds and eat the figs off my fig tree and poop all over everything. I complain and complain, but no one will help us," said Sarina Sanfelice, 82, who keeps a garden hose by her front door. NY Daily News.
